Can I replace the SSD drive? (current one is defect)

Microsoft International Warranty doesn't work if you buy from USA and want to ask for warranty in Europe.

I have the option paying almost entire device cost as custom fee and shipping, throwing to the garbage bin, or repair it.

To repair I need to open it and replace the SSD drive. Would you recommend this route? How risky is... do you know the type of SSD used?

the surface book has not got a normal ssd it is pci style ssd so don't buy the ssd before you see what you need . It can be a bit of a pain to get into but if it comes down to chucking it or repairing it give, it a try

Hello!

Is it possible to use a hairdryer instead of the "iOpener"?

If yes, what would be the precautions to take on?

Thanks

Cette réponse est-elle utile ?

Indice 0

1 commentaire:

Possible, but suboptimal. The glue is strong and your hairdryer probably won't get hot enough, A Heat Gun available at a local hardware shop would be better, but be careful, you don't want to damage the screen through over heating that might damage the panel or too much uneven heat making the glass vulnerable to cracking. Take care to apply heat evenly and have many guitar picks and suction cups ready.
